Subject: Key rotation — Relayforge config service

Team,

We rotated the Relayforge internal API key today after the hot-reload audit. Reminder: Relayforge watches its config file and reloads on write, so no restart is needed — the new key takes effect within ~5 seconds of the file landing. Old key is revoked at 18:00 UTC. Verify your reviewers' checklist item 4 (no cached credentials in memory past reload). Staging has already been switched. The new key for the config service follows.

API key for tagef-fafop: vxb2-ta

Alert: HarborCart checkout load test threshold breached

This alert fires when the nightly load test against the Saltmere checkout flow records p95 latency above 1200ms or an error rate over 2%. It usually indicates a regression in the payment orchestration step rather than infrastructure. Check the most recent deploy to the checkout service first, then compare against last night's baseline run. Triage steps and baseline dashboards are on the internal page below.

wiki page, bagef-yahag: https://confluence.lumiclabs.internal/projects/browse/browse/projects/1a81

## Deploying the Gatewick Proctor Queue

Deploys are pretty painless: push to main, wait for the pipeline, then watch the queue drain dashboard for five minutes. If candidates pile up mid-exam, roll back first and ask questions later — the queue replays safely. Everything the workers care about lives in one config block, shown here for reference.

settings of bafof-yagef:
JOROX_PIN=8740
JOROX_TENANT=pelox
JOROX_METRICS_HOST=metrics.jorox.qorvelworks.internal
JOROX_SEAL=seal_c78f63c1
JOROX_STANDBY_TEAM=norax

Handover: Tracing on the Lattice Platform

To whoever inherits this from me (most recently Priya at Fenwick Systems): trace IDs are minted in the Gatehouse edge proxy and propagated via the x-lattice-trace header. The billing and notifier services still strip it on retries — there's a patch half-finished in the spanfix branch. Sampling is set to 10% in production; do not raise it without checking collector disk usage first. The collector's recovery passphrase is recorded directly below this note.

unlock words, hahip-baduf: holwyn-istath-julvan